    Default J'onn J'onzz pronouciation

    I had just had a totally random thought- how exactly is the Martian Manhunter J'onn J'onzz's name supposed to be pronounced? Does it sound like "John Johns," or like "Jay-on Jay-ons"? I know his human guise calls himself John Jones. Always been curious, just never asked anyone before.
